What are the types of PCB capacitors? Types of PCB capacitors
There are several types of PCB capacitors available in the market, each with unique features and specifications. Some of the commonly used PCB capacitors types are: ● Ceramic capacitors: These are the most commonly used type of PCB capacitors. They are small, inexpensive, and offer stable performance over a wide range of frequencies.

Discrete capacitors placed in PCBs and substrates are off-the-shelf components, designated low-profile MLCCs. While not specifically designed for embedding in substrates or PCBs, they can be embedded in these materials thanks to their lower-than-normal profile. These low-profile MLCCs from Murata can be used for embedding.
